this episode of the UKRunChat podcast, we're joined by ultra runners, authors, and adventurers Jen & Sim Benson. They share stories of epic challenges, why ultras feel like “supported adventures,” and how the community makes the sport so special.

We also dive into their brand-new book, Ultra: The World Atlas of Ultramarathons — a beautifully curated guide to iconic and lesser-known races around the globe. Whether you’re dreaming of UTMB, curious about Mongolia’s remote ultra, or wondering if you really can walk a 100k, this episode has insights and inspiration for every trail runner.

Topics covered:

  • Jen & Sim’s journey from road marathons and climbing to ultras (00:23)
  • Why ultras are “adventures with support” (03:26)
  • Races that stood out, including Arc of Attrition 100 and TDS at UTMB (01:26, 06:57)
  • Inside their new book Ultra — and how they chose which races made the cut (09:01, 13:36)
  • Bucket-list ultras from Mongolia to the Trans-Alpine (15:02)
  • Advice for first-time ultra runners: why it might not be as scary as it sounds (17:01)
  • Walking an ultra — and why it might just be the best way to finish strong and avoid blisters (19:19)
  • Navigation skills and mountain craft (23:47)
  • Mental preparation, mindfulness, and dealing with “bad patches” (28:07)
  • Future races and writing projects (34:30)
  • The future of ultra running and community growth (40:02)
